
Withdrawing money from ATM to become expensive from today, salary-pension will come even on holidays
- There will be no hassle of non-payment of salary or pension on weekly holidays or government holidays from the month of August.
- That is, even if there is a Saturday-Sunday or any declared holiday on the 30th, 31st, the salary will come in the pension account.
- But customers will have to lose more pockets on cash withdrawal from ATM. ICICI Bank has also increased banking charges.
- From August 1, ATM cash withdrawal will become expensive, as the RBI has increased the interchange fee on financial transactions from one bank to another through ATMs from Rs 15 to Rs 17.
- RBI took this decision in June, which will come into effect today. Fees for non-financial transactions have also been increased from Rs.5 to Rs.6.
